Porter, WI is an area with a high median housing value of $354,300 compared to the US median house value of $338,100. Over the past year, house appreciation in Porter has been higher than the US average of 8.27%, with a 1 year house appreciation of 12.97%. This indicates that this area is desirable and housing prices are likely to increase further. The market in Porter appears to be healthy and it may be a great opportunity for potential buyers looking to invest in real estate.

The median home cost in Porter is $354,300.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 77.0%. Home Appreciation in Porter is up 15.0%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Porter real estate is 47 years old
The Rental Market in Porter
- Renters make up 17.1% of the Porter population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in Porter, are available to rent
